Transaction 5bbf1ff195ed8ecd57a77f216ca07fbbaba103788bc81e553cd5254ea34e0146
3 Input
2 Outputs
- 5bbf1ff195ed8ecd57a77f216ca07fbbaba103788bc81e553cd5254ea34e0146:0
- 5bbf1ff195ed8ecd57a77f216ca07fbbaba103788bc81e553cd5254ea34e0146:1
value 651091
address 3KFGH2xmWb9L2SXAg1mCNFu23G1LA6WyjV
value 448780
address 3BMEXVs3XfVRr51wm4DQWALfwEuriDiPXk